Connector Details

On 3G & 3GS Connector # are as follows

Connector # 1 : LCD Display
Connector # 2 : Touch Screen Digitizer
Connector # 3 : Ear Piece Speaker, Proximity and Ambient Light Sensor
Connector # 4 : Charge Port, Home Button, Antennae, Microphone and Speakerphone
